MySQL实现在()顺序排序通过find_in_set()函数

本文将介绍一个教程关于MySQL实现在(),用find_in_set()函数教程。希望本教程能对你有所帮助。




SELECT * FROM表ID('783、769、814、1577、1769)
为了find_in_set(ID,'783,769, 814, 1577,1769)


检查:




七百六十九
一千五百七十七
八百一十四
一千七百六十九
七百八十三



为什么不是78376981415771769号订单



注:在搜索,原因是在find_in_set。如果有在find_in_set二参数空间,这将导致以去,因为MySQL查询不会给你修剪空白。



所以…



空间之后:




SELECT * FROM表ID('783、769、814、1577、1769)
为了find_in_set(ID,'78376981415771769)



注意力被转移了。

空间'78376981415771769




退房:
七百八十三
七百六十九
八百一十四
一千五百七十七
一千七百六十九



在这一点上,我们意识到那种在find_in_set,和find_in_set也可以尝试多条件排序。

总结

以上是关于MySQL的find_in_set(中)(哪里)功能介绍所有的排序顺序,感兴趣的朋友可以看看:MySQL数据库表分区注意大全{推荐},MySQL中的几个重要变量,SQL和MySQL语句的执行顺序的分析,如有不足之处,欢迎留言。希望对你有帮助。